Farmersville Historical Society Auction

LIVE Auction at The Historic Bain-Honaker House along with Cedar Hollow Winery serving our guests!
Several months ago, Brookshires Grocery Store contacted our President and allocated the large hanging historic photos they had that the Farmersville Historical Society provided the photos for. There are 24 total, and we have sawed off the food side of these. The large photos measure approximately 5 feet wide, by 4 feet tall. The photos are on a wood laminate type board. They are ready for hanging and can also be placed on a shelf or a ledge by themselves.
The 24 photos are of the historic downtown Farmersville and area, local businesses, and some local homes. These photos are EXTREMELY IDEAL for LOCAL BUSINESSES!!!!!!! You just might see YOUR business or home in these photos!
We are also clearing out our smokehouse, which stores a lot of our historic furniture and items that we no longer have use for. We will be auctioning these items off as well.
Cedar Hollow will be on the grounds and we are so excited to have them out again! They have always been such a great sponsor of ours at our Annual Spring Luncheon, and they are a perfect fit for this evening's event!
Come out and stroll the grounds, and take a look at all of these photos that will be lining the grounds while you sip your wine before Clay Potter starts off our auctioning!
ALL PROCEEDS from the auction will go towards our preservation efforts of The Historic Bain-Honaker House & Museum

Trick-It-Up Bike Ride

Whether you ride for fun, the challenge or just the passion of pedaling, when you ride in the Farmersville Trick-It-Up-Bike Ride you will see some beautiful countryside from our point of view. Join us and about 500 other riders for our 15th annual bike ride.

--Trick It Up Bike Ride is Saturday, October 26, 2024 — the ride starts at 9 AM and ends at 3 PM.
--Trick It Up just means that you can add a Halloween theme or personal flare to your attire or bike (optional fun)!
--The ride starts at 9 AM at our Historic Onion Shed – 154 S. Main Street Farmersville, TX 75442
YOU CAN REGISTER THE DAY OF THE RIDE STARTING AT 7AM for $60
--The ride ends at 3 PM — No food, beer, rest stops, or sag after 3 PM
--We have 22, 32, 42, 51, and 60 mile rides
Routes are available on RideWithGPS
